- [ ] **Step 7: Breaker override escrow.** After sealing the signing keys for the Tallgrove upstream API circuit breaker, confirm the support team can force the breaker open during a full outage. The override bundle lives in the sealed escrow drawer and is useless without its unlock phrase. Two ceremony witnesses must initial this step before proceeding. The escrow bundle is decrypted with the recovery passphrase that follows.

vault phrase of kahip-kahop = holath-quenmir

**Q: Why does the Shelfwright catalogue import skip records with blank call numbers?**

Good question — it's intentional. The importer at Pellbrook Library flags those rows into a quarantine table instead of failing the whole batch, so reviewers can patch them later. If you're reviewing the retry logic, note that quarantined rows need the maintenance vault unlocked first. The passphrase to open it is below.

strongbox words: praath-queniel-holax-druael-jorath-noveth-druok

## Runbook: Gaugepile Sidecar — Release Checklist

Heads up: the sidecar ships with every app pod, so a bad config fans out fast. Before cutting a release, confirm the flush interval hasn't drifted from what the Tallyhouse aggregator expects, or you'll see sawtooth gaps in dashboards. Rollbacks are cheap — just repin the image tag. Canary one node pool first, watch for ten minutes, then proceed. The values to verify against are these.

config for bagep-yafof:
quenath:
  pin: 8584
  metrics_host: metrics.quenath.tolvaqsys.internal
  tenant: pelath
  seal: seal_ed102645

Release checklist — Tandem Calendar v4.2 (Briarcloud). Verify the sync-conflict resolver before cutoff: two clients editing the same event offline must merge to last-writer-wins on the title and union on attendees. Regression from v4.1 duplicated recurring events after a conflict; fix is in the merge layer, gated behind the conflictMergeV2 flag. Flag must be ON in staging, OFF in prod until sign-off. Run the conflict suite against the Ostler tenant and attach results. The staging build that passed the suite is recorded below.

build token for haduf-bafog: htk21_2d98ce91a83676b65394a